Our Private Business Transfer Pricing team supports clients’ cross‑border transactions and expansion plans, assesses their international tax strategies and provides a range of services supporting clients through the transfer pricing life cycle, including designing, implementing, documenting, monitoring and defending intercompany pricing policies that align their global tax model with the business strategy.

The client base is very broad with a focus on privately owned UK‑headquartered groups, including fast‑growth start‑ups and businesses backed by private equity.
